C TGP VIP Transport Planner
The activities are carried out within a transport and logistics organization of a government agency. This organization is responsible for the worldwide transport of persons and goods, physical mail processing, and the management of civilian service vehicles. The passenger transport service plans and executes non-operational passenger transport, subdivided into group transport, patient transport, and VIP transport.
What you will do.
- Daily work preparation for VIP transport.
- Managing training administration.
- Leading planners/team leaders.
- Allocating the capacity of the work unit for transport assignments.
- Ensuring the continuity of staffing for planners/team leaders for the primary process.
- Drawing up a work plan and setting priorities.
- Monitoring the progress of execution and acting on bottlenecks.
- Creating a balanced planning.
- Monitoring the Working Hours Act (ATW).
- Having internal (physical) transport controls carried out by planners.
- Ensuring the completeness of necessary data and associated instructions for the KVD.
- Coordinating training within the work unit.
- Drawing up schedules and sub-orders related to training.
- Monitoring the validity period of certificates.
- Monitoring the registration of training results.
